Small excerpt below where she seems to give us some respect.

Millions of Americans, many with thoughtful positions, oppose what they call a globalist agenda. For instance, GOP presidential candidate and Congressman Ron Paul opposes both the World Trade Organization and NAFTA, saying they are not about so-called “free trade…in practice,” but are really about free trade for special interests (such as agriculture, Big Pharma and financial services)........
